Deep Fried S’mores

Core Ingredients
- Graham Crackers: Enough to make squares slightly larger than marshmallows (about 8 sheets)
- Large Marshmallows: 8 pieces
- Chocolate Bars (milk or dark): 8 pieces, sized to fit between graham crackers
Batter
- All-Purpose Flour: 1 cup
- Baking Powder: 1 teaspoon
- Milk: 3/4 cup
- Egg: 1 large
For Frying
- Vegetable Oil: Enough for deep frying (about 4 cups)
Optional Garnishes
- Powdered Sugar: for dusting
- Chocolate Sauce: for drizzling
- Caramel Sauce: for drizzling
- Prepare Your S’mores Foundation: Break graham crackers into squares slightly larger than marshmallows. Place a piece of chocolate and one marshmallow between two graham cracker squares and gently press to secure. Arrange assembled s’mores on a tray for easy dipping.
- Make the Batter: In a mixing bowl, whisk together all-purpose flour, baking powder, milk, and egg until the batter is smooth and slightly thick, perfect for coating the s’mores.
- Heat the Oil: Fill a deep pot or fryer with vegetable oil and heat it to 350°F (175°C). Use a thermometer to maintain this temperature to ensure even frying.
- Batter and Fry: Carefully dip each assembled s’more into the batter, ensuring it is fully coated. Gently lower it into the hot oil and fry for 2-3 minutes, turning if necessary, until the exterior is golden brown and crisp.
- Drain and Serve: Remove deep fried s’mores with a slotted spoon and place on paper towels to absorb excess oil. Serve warm, optionally dusted with powdered sugar or drizzled with chocolate or caramel sauce.
Notes
- Keep oil temperature stable using a thermometer to avoid greasy or burnt s’mores.
- Fry in small batches to prevent overcrowding and ensure even cooking.
- Press graham crackers tightly around the fillings to prevent leaks during frying.
- Use cold fillings to slow melting and maintain gooey centers.
- Serve immediately for best texture and flavor.
